What was conditional ratification? An anonymous author wrote a set of documents urging the adoption of the U.S. Constitution. Th

ese documents were signed "Conditional Ratifier." Article VII of the Constitution, which lays out the conditions for ratification. Massachusetts and four other states ratified the Constitution with the condition that it would be amended soon after it went into effect. The Federalist warning that the United States would be in a terrible condition if it did not ratify the Constitution.

Answer:

Massachusetts and four other states ratified the Constitution with the condition that it would be amended soon after it went into effect.

Explanation:

Many States were anti-federalists and were strongly opposed the ratification of the US Constitution because they said the Constitution created such a strong central government that it had the power of tyranny and that the Constitution did not have a system that protected the individual rights. This way, Massachusetts and other states made the conditional ratification. They decided to ratify the Constitution under the condition it would be amended soon after so they could create a protection system of individual rights. This happened and the Bill of Rights was created.
